Ecosistema Desarrollo
Por qué desarrollar dentro de Dinaup marca la diferencia
Cuando estás montando algo importante —tu negocio, tu proyecto, tu idea—, cada decisión cuenta. Y una de las decisiones más importantes es dónde vas a construirlo.
Usar Dinaup es como construir dentro de un edificio que ya tiene cimientos, paredes, electricidad, fontanería y seguridad. Puedes dedicarte a decorar, a hacer que funcione y se vea bien. Si decides construir por tu cuenta, empezarás desde cero, con todas las responsabilidades sobre tus hombros. Eso puede salir bien… o puede darte muchos dolores de cabeza.
A continuación te explicamos, con ejemplos reales y un lenguaje claro, por qué quedarse dentro del ecosistema Dinaup es una decisión inteligente.
🔐 Gestión de secretos – Evitar errores que pueden costar muy caros
Cuando un programador crea una app, necesita usar contraseñas y claves especiales para que todo funcione: conectarse a una base de datos, enviar emails, hacer pagos… Esas claves se llaman secretos.
Un problema muy común es que los desarrolladores, con prisas o por costumbre, meten esas claves en archivos que suben a GitHub (una herramienta para guardar el código). ¿El resultado? Esas contraseñas acaban siendo públicas sin que nadie se dé cuenta. Cualquiera podría usarlas para acceder a tu información o destruir tus datos.
Cómo lo resolvemos en Dinaup
Por eso creamos Dinaup Vault, un sistema que obliga a los desarrolladores a guardar esas claves de forma segura, lejos del código. Además:
Si cambia una contraseña, no hay que ir una por una cambiándola en cada servidor/aplicación.
Varias aplicaciones pueden usar el mismo secreto sin copiar y pegarlo mil veces.
Se evitan errores humanos. Se automatiza lo que suele fallar.
Los secretos se guardan encriptados.
📁 Gestión de archivos – Porque los archivos son más importantes de lo que parecen
Al principio todo parece fácil: “Guardamos los archivos en un servidor y ya”. Pero conforme pasa el tiempo, el volumen crece, cambian los equipos, se quiere mostrar una imagen en la web o acceder a un documento antiguo... y empiezan los problemas.
Muchos equipos externos guardan los archivos en servidores propios que no están preparados para compartir, versionar o proteger esos datos. Por ejemplo, quizás no se puedan utilizar las imágenes para ponerlas visibles en un Marketplace o no se le pueda dar acceso a una empresa integradora, porque las imágenes públicas se guardan junto a documentación confidencial.
Cómo lo resolvemos en Dinaup
En Dinaup, los archivos se guardan automáticamente en varias ubicaciones distintas, protegidos incluso frente a fallos de proveedores o accidentes humanos, desastres naturales. Además:
Guardamos todas las versiones de los archivos, para que se sobrescribe, se pueda recuperar.
Los archivos no “desaparecen” si un servidor se cae.
Un hacker o error humano borra el FTP.
Puedes compartirlos con enlaces temporales seguros (útil para mostrar imágenes en una web, por ejemplo) (URLs firmadas).
Caso real: Una empresa guardaba sus archivos en su propio servidor. Un día quisieron integrar esas imágenes en una tienda online, pero su servidor no permitía generar enlaces temporales. Tuvieron que migrar todo de urgencia. En Dinaup, eso está resuelto desde el principio.
🧠 Base de datos – Donde vive toda la información
Cuando creas una app fuera de Dinaup, tienes que crear una base de datos desde cero: configurarla, protegerla, hacer copias de seguridad, vincularla con otros sistemas…
Cada vez que quieras obtener estadísticas, imprimir un informe o relacionar información con tus clientes, tendrás que construirlo tú o pagar por ello.
Cómo lo resolvemos en Dinaup
Si construyes dentro de Dinaup, no necesitas una base de datos adicional. Todos los datos están conectados, seguros, y disponibles desde el panel de control (Play Dinaup).
Puedes usar el sistema de informes, gráficas y plantillas sin crear nada nuevo.
Ahorras costes de infraestructura (no hay que pagar por servidores extra).
Si cambias de equipo de desarrollo, el nuevo entiende rápidamente cómo funciona todo (porque seguimos estándares comunes).
Ejemplo: Una empresa de golf desarrolló su app por fuera. Todo funcionaba, pero no podían cruzar datos con sus clientes, ni hacer informes, ni enviar documentos desde Dinaup. Ni realizar plantillas de impresión. Rehicieron la app sobre nuestra API y no solo solucionaron eso, sino que redujeron el coste a una décima parte.
🧩 API – Cuando todo habla el mismo idioma, todo fluye
A medida que una empresa crece, también crece su “zoológico de aplicaciones”: una para facturar, otra para fichar, otra para tareas, otra para campañas, otra para el Drive, el correo, Excel, etc.
Cada aplicación tiene su propio idioma, y eso complica mucho que hablen entre sí.
Cómo lo resolvemos en Dinaup
Nuestra API actúa como un intérprete universal. En lugar de que cada nueva app tenga que “aprender todos los idiomas”, solo necesita hablar con Dinaup.
Eso reduce muchísimo el coste de desarrollo.
Facilita cambiar de proveedor sin perder el conocimiento técnico.
Evita duplicar datos o errores de sincronización.
🔄 Independencia del equipo de desarrollo – Que tu proyecto no dependa de una sola persona
Cuando empiezas un proyecto con un equipo de desarrollo externo, al principio todo va bien. Pero con el tiempo, pueden pasar cosas:
El programador se va.
Cambias de proveedor.
El proyecto crece y necesitas más manos.
O simplemente, el equipo ya no responde igual.
Y entonces te das cuenta de algo importante: nadie más entiende cómo está montado eso.
No hay documentación. Todo es “a medida”. Y si alguien nuevo entra, le cuesta semanas —o meses— ponerse al día. Tu negocio queda atrapado en una caja negra.
Cómo lo resolvemos en Dinaup
Cuando desarrollas sobre Dinaup, el sistema está estandarizado. Eso significa que:
Cualquier otro equipo (certificado o nuevo) puede continuar el trabajo sin partir de cero.
Hay documentación y buenas prácticas comunes.
Usas herramientas compartidas como Play Dinaup, Dinaup Vault, Dianuo Logs, Ready To Blazor, GitHub y ReadyToAutomate, que hacen que todo sea transparente.
Los datos y configuraciones están en tu cuenta. No dependes de quién hizo el desarrollo.
Última actualización
¿Te fue útil?